4th of July fireworks - from 400 feet up! These are frame captures from the video captured with my DJI Phantom 2 Vision quadcopter. We went to the annual fireworks show hosted by the city of Independence, and the RLDS church for Independence day (where better to spend Independence day than in Independence!). Anyway, we took the Phantom along, and after the show started, I ran across the street and launched the Phantom away from the crowd (launch site: 39 05 63N 94 25 38W). This was a record-breaking flight. Not only did I go higher than ever before, it was the longest continuous flight - nearly 20 minutes. I still had 40% on my battery, so I'm sure it would have gone the advertised 25 minutes with ease. I pushed her to 400 feet, which is the maximum height under FAA regulations for radio-controlled hobbyist aircraft. The video is spectacular - and I'm working on putting together a video to post to YouTube shortly. While I was flying, an Independence Police Officer came over, and asked if my drone was a Phantom - turned out his brother has an older model of the Phantom. He was fascinated with the live video on the Ipad - he thought it was the coolest thing he'd seen in a while. He's standing beside me in the last frame. After the fireworks ended, I gave him a quick 360 view with the Community of Christ Center (the brilliantly lighted building), and the Temple. As the Phantom touched down, quite a crowd had gathered, and I spent the next 10 minutes answering questions, and talking with folks about "drones." I had several folks tell me they were as fascinated watching the Phantom as they were with the fireworks (the quad has high-intensity red and green LED's on the bottom so you can tell the front from the rear - and it's really easy to see at night). With all the negative press they frequently get, I'm always happy to show folks that 'drones' can be our friends as well. Anyway, it was a fun night, and I'll post the video soon.
